What is a part time bookkeeper?

A Part-Time Bookkeeper is responsible for managing financial records, tracking transactions, and ensuring accurate reporting for a business on a reduced-hour schedule. They typically handle tasks like invoicing, payroll, bank reconciliation, and expense tracking. This role is ideal for businesses that need financial management but do not require a full-time bookkeeper. Part-time bookkeepers often work remotely or on-site for small to medium-sized businesses.

What are the typical responsibilities of a part time bookkeeper?

As a Part Time Bookkeeper, your routine tasks often include recording financial transactions, reconciling bank statements, managing accounts payable and receivable, and preparing basic financial reports. You may also assist with payroll processing, monitor cash flow, and support budgeting efforts depending on the size of the company. Bookkeepers frequently communicate with business owners, managers, or external accountants to clarify financial information and answer questions. Since the role is part-time, responsibilities are often prioritized based on deadlines and the company’s needs, allowing for flexibility in your work schedule.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a part time bookkeeper?

To thrive as a Part Time Bookkeeper, you need strong attention to detail, solid mathematical skills, and a basic understanding of accounting principles, often supported by relevant coursework or prior experience. Familiarity with accounting software such as QuickBooks or Xero, as well as proficiency in spreadsheets and possibly certification like a Bookkeeping Certificate, is typically required. Excellent organizational skills, reliability, and effective communication help you manage multiple tasks and work seamlessly with clients or team members. These skills are vital for maintaining accurate financial records, ensuring compliance, and supporting overall business operations.

How to get into part-time bookkeeper?

To become a part-time bookkeeper, candidates typically need basic accounting skills, proficiency with accounting software like QuickBooks,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Gaining relevant experience through internships or entry-level positions can improve job prospects, and some employers may prefer candidates with bookkeeping certifications or coursework in accounting. Flexibility and attention to detail are important for success in this role.
